IHG’s Intercontinental brand is to open its first property in Venice, housed within a converted 16th century palace.
The Intercontinental Venice – Palazzo Nani is scheduled to open in 2018, and will feature 51 rooms, a wellness centre, meeting facilities and a club lounge.
Located on Cannaregio Canal, connecting the Grand Canal to the centre of Venice, the palace features hand painted alfresco ceilings and hand-carved wooden beams which will be restored.
Last month IHG announced its first property in Bulgaria, scheduled to open in 2017 and housed within the current Radisson Blu Grand Hotel Sofia (see news February 26).
